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you need to make this Cottage Cheese Broccoli Cheddar Soup. Each ingredient adds to the creamy, savory, and vibrant magic.
- Butter (2 tablespoons): Adds richness and flavor for sautéing.
- Onion (1, chopped): Provides a sweet, savory base.
- Garlic (2 cloves, minced): Infuses aromatic depth.
- Broccoli Florets (4 cups): The star ingredient, delivering earthy flavor and nutrition.
- Vegetable Broth (4 cups): Adds depth and creates the perfect soup consistency.
- Cottage Cheese (1 cup): Creates a creamy, protein-rich texture.
- Shredded Cheddar Cheese (1 cup): Adds melty, cheesy flavor.
- Salt and Pepper (to taste): Seasons the soup to perfection.
- Croutons (optional, for garnish): Provides a crunchy topping.
Substitutions and Variations
- Butter: Swap with olive oil or vegan butter for a dairy-free version.
- Broccoli: Use cauliflower, zucchini, or a mix of green vegetables for a twist.
- Cottage Cheese: Replace with ricotta, Greek yogurt, or vegan cream cheese for a dairy-free option.
- Cheddar Cheese: Swap with Gouda, Colby, or a vegan cheddar alternative.
- Vegetable Broth: Substitute with chicken broth (if not vegetarian) or water with a bouillon cube.
- Add-Ins: Stir in ½ teaspoon smoked paprika, a pinch of red pepper flakes for heat, or ¼ cup heavy cream for extra richness.
- Garnish: Use fresh herbs like parsley or chives instead of croutons, or sprinkle with bacon bits for non-vegetarian flair.
Step-by-Step Instructions
Making this Cottage Cheese Broccoli Cheddar Soup is simple and rewarding! Follow these steps for a perfect bowl every time.
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ics
- Melt 2 tablespoons butter in a large pot over medium heat.
- Add 1 chopped onion and 2 minced garlic cloves, and sauté for 5–7 minutes until translucent and fragrant.
Tip: Stir occasionally to prevent burning; onions should be soft, not browned.
Step 2: Cook the Broccoli
- Add 4 cups broccoli florets and 4 cups vegetable broth to the pot.
-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er for about 10 minutes, until the broccoli is tender.
Tip: Test broccoli with a fork; it should be soft but not mushy for the best texture.
Step 3: Blend the Soup
- Use an immersion blender to puree the soup to your desired consistency (smooth or slightly chunky).
- Stir in 1 cup cottage cheese and 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ese, blending or stirring until fully melted and smooth.
Tip: If using a regular blender, work in batches and blend carefully to avoid hot splashes; return to the pot after blending.
Step 4: Season and Serve
- Season the soup with salt and pepper to taste.
-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
- Ladle into bowls and garnish with croutons or fresh herbs, if desired.
Tip: For a smoother soup, blend longer or strain through a fine mesh sieve (optional).

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ips
This soup is ideal for making ahead or enjoying as leftovers. Here’s how to keep it fresh:
- Storing Leftovers:
-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
- Freeze for up to 3 months in a freezer-safe container; leave space for expansion.
- Reheating:
- Reheat on the stovetop over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until warmed through (5–7 minutes).
- Microwave individual portions for 1–2 minutes, stirring halfway to ensure even heating.
- Make-Ahead Tips:
- Prep onion, garlic, and broccoli up to a day ahead and store in the fridge.
- Make the soup (without garnish) up to 2 days ahead and refrigerate; add croutons or herbs when serving.
- Freeze in portion-sized containers for easy reheating.
Tip: Stir well after reheating to restore creaminess; add a splash of broth if it thickens too much.

FAQs
1. Can I use frozen broccoli?
Yes! Use frozen broccoli florets and simmer slightly longer (12–15 minutes) to ensure tenderness; no need to thaw.
2. Is this soup healthy?
Yes! It’s high in protein from cottage cheese and cheddar, plus nutrients from broccoli. Use low-sodium broth and less cheese for a lighter option.
3. Can I make it dairy-free?
Yes! Use vegan butter, vegan cream cheese, and dairy-free cheddar cheese.
4. Why is my soup grainy?
- Blend thoroughly to fully incorporate the cottage cheese.
- Use full-fat cottage cheese and cheddar for smoother texture.
- Avoid overheating after adding cheese to prevent curdling.
